Jason D'Aquino: matches are not a toy, but art

American artist Jason D'Aquino (Jason D'Aquino) is engaged in a rare genre in modern art — miniature. If you really want to be original, then be it to the end, Jason decided, and began to draw his miniatures on matchboxes. He usually prefers political and cinematic themes; among the latter, episodes from classic science fiction productions and noir films predominate. Bravo, Mr. D'Aquino!

His work seems to come from the last century, from the elegant 50s and 60s — such "retro boxes". All drawings are made with graphite rods, a magnifying glass is also used.
